    Getting into ILI: Eligibility and Admission

    So, you're keen on applying for an Indian Law Institute LLM admission? Awesome! But before you get too excited, let's talk about the eligibility criteria. ILI usually has specific requirements, so you'll want to make sure you tick all the boxes. First off, you'll need a Bachelor of Laws (LLB) degree or an equivalent law degree from a recognized university. The degree must be recognized by the Bar Council of India. Typically, you'll also need to have a certain percentage of marks in your LLB, often around 50% or higher, but this can vary, so double-check the official guidelines.

    ILI usually conducts its own entrance exam for LLM admissions. The entrance exam typically tests your legal knowledge, analytical skills, and general aptitude. The exam might include multiple-choice questions, essay writing, and possibly an interview. The exam tests a candidate's knowledge and comprehension of the law. You'll need to study up on various legal topics, including constitutional law, contract law, criminal law, and other core subjects. Be prepared to analyze legal concepts, apply legal principles to hypothetical scenarios, and write clear and concise answers.

    Besides the entrance exam, ILI may also consider other factors, such as your academic record, work experience (if any), and any publications or research you've done.     The Cost of Education: ILI LLM Fees

    Let's talk about money, guys. The Indian Law Institute LLM fees are an important factor to consider when planning your studies. The fees can vary from year to year, so it's always best to check the latest information on the ILI website or contact the admissions office directly. The fee structure usually includes tuition fees, which cover the cost of your courses, and other charges, such as library fees, examination fees, and student activity fees. The fees at ILI are generally considered to be reasonable compared to some other private law schools. The institute may also offer scholarships or financial aid to deserving students.
